2011-05-10 13 views
5

मैं json कि phpप्रक्रिया JSON उत्तर एकल स्ट्रिंग

json_encode('Test string'); 

यह स्ट्रिंग वापस मैं फ़ायरबग के साथ की जाँच भेजता में इस तरह दिखता है। मैं इसे कैसे एक्सेस कर सकता हूं?

success: function(theResponse) {   

      alert() 

    } 

मुझे उस स्ट्रिंग को प्राप्त करने के लिए मुझे अलर्ट के अंदर क्या रखना चाहिए?

उत्तर

4

आप अपने आउटपुट के रूप में मान्य JSON भले ही यह एक स्ट्रिंग के प्रारूप चाहिए:

json_encode(array("message" => "No Return Email Address Specified!")); 

तो फिर तुम इस तरह जे एस में इसे का उपयोग कर सकते हैं:।

success: function(theResponse) {   

     alert(theResponse.message) 

} 
+1

JSON को किसी सरणी या ऑब्जेक्ट की तरह संरचना होने की आवश्यकता नहीं है। एक स्ट्रिंग का एक उदाहरण वैध JSON है। –

+0

बेशक, लेकिन यदि यह शब्दकोश है तो स्ट्रिंग को कैसे पहुंचाया जाना चाहिए इस पर कोई संदेह नहीं है :-) – Xion

-1

उपयोग $ प्रतिक्रिया ऑब्जेक्ट

पर
success: function(theResponse) {   
    alert(theResponse.$) 
} 
संबंधित मुद्दे